Greetings all,
This is my first time tring to set up a VPN connection so please feel free to share your experience and knowledge.

ok.. here's what I have. A ADSL connection, a Linksys DSL router BEFSR41, PcAnywhere 10.5 and a Windows Small business 2000 Server.

I have a clients desktop with XP home edition on it that I want to give VPN access first.

The router is also the DHCp server for the lan.

-----
All I want to do is connect to the W2K server from the XP home desktop or any other desktop - say for example a win2000pro machine - using the VPN connection from the linksys router and also using PcAnywhere 10.5 as the remote assitance software.

I've read a fair amount of information about all the products mentioned above and I'm still am unable to establish a vpn connection.

This is the error I get when I try to establish a vpn session on my vpn connection which I created under start>settings>Network Connection> on the xp home desktop.

Error: 800: unable to establish the vpn connection. The VPN server may be unreachable, or security parameters may not be configured properly for this connection.

On the side question:
When a click on my VPN connection under start>settings>Network Connection> I created and try to set up a vpn session before using pcanywhere to do the remote work, can you tell what username and what password they are asking me to use? Is it the routers username and password or the users win2000 server username and password. I've tried both and I can not get in my lan.

Is there any thing more I have to do on the router? I've enabled ipsec passthrough and pptp pass through.


Thanks for your help!



 
Regarding your PCanywhere issue

On the host computer you create your profile with user and password information. On your remote you need to creat a profile with the same user and password. As far as the linksys you need to forward the appropriate ports. Also, the linksys Befsr41 only allows one vpn at a time. In the vpn situatioin you need to configure the router with the appropriate ports. That is about all it takes.
